The Global Ultrasound Institute applauds UAB’s School of Medicine for a groundbreaking achievement.

Securing a $2 million federal grant, the school has equipped every student with point-of-care ultrasound units, guaranteeing comprehensive education in POCUS. A significant stride towards advancing medical learning!
